How Does Power Output Affect the Performance of a Compact Marine Amplifier?

  • Wattage Ratings: The wattage rating indicates the amount of power the amplifier can deliver to the speakers. Higher wattage ratings typically translate to louder sound levels and better performance in overcoming environmental noise, making it essential for marine settings where wind and water sounds can interfere with audio clarity.
  • Efficiency: The efficiency of an amplifier refers to how well it converts power from the battery into usable audio output. Compact marine amplifiers with higher efficiency ratings can provide greater output with less power consumption, which is crucial for maintaining battery life during extended outings on the water.
  • Heat Dissipation: Amplifiers generate heat during operation, and those with higher power outputs may require better heat management systems. A compact marine amplifier that effectively dissipates heat can maintain performance without distortion, ensuring reliable audio quality even during prolonged use.
  • Sound Quality: The power output directly affects the sound quality, especially at higher volumes. Ample power can help prevent clipping and distortion, allowing for a clear and dynamic sound reproduction that enhances the overall listening experience on a boat.
  • Compatibility with Speakers: The power output of the amplifier must match the specifications of the connected speakers for optimal performance. Using a compact marine amplifier with the appropriate power output can maximize the speaker’s efficiency and ensure that they perform well without being underpowered or overdriven.

Why Is Waterproof Protection Crucial for a Marine Amplifier?

Waterproof protection is crucial for a marine amplifier because these devices are often exposed to harsh marine environments, including saltwater, humidity, and fluctuating temperatures, which can lead to corrosion and electrical failures.

According to a study published by the Journal of Marine Technology, electronics used in marine applications face greater risks of damage due to the presence of saltwater, which accelerates corrosion processes (Journal of Marine Technology, 2021). Without adequate waterproofing, a marine amplifier can quickly deteriorate, leading to reduced performance and ultimately rendering the device unusable.

The underlying mechanism involves the interaction between moisture and electrical components. When water infiltrates an amplifier, it can create short circuits, disrupt signal flow, and cause components to corrode. This is particularly problematic in marine settings where saltwater can create conductive pathways that drastically increase the risk of electrical failures. Additionally, the presence of moisture can promote the growth of mold and mildew, further compromising the integrity of electronic devices.

Furthermore, the fluctuating temperatures typical in marine environments can exacerbate these issues. As temperatures rise and fall, moisture can condense inside the amplifier, leading to internal corrosion even if the exterior remains intact. This highlights the importance of choosing a marine amplifier specifically designed with waterproof features, ensuring longevity and reliability in challenging conditions.
